It has solid lifters and shims. My 80 Kawasaki kz1000 has the same adjustment.

Valve Clearance Adjustment
Remove the camshafts.

Use compressed air to remove the shims that require replacing.
Blow compressed air between the shim edge and bucket to dislodge the shim.
Use the following formula to calculate the required shim thickness.
Original shim thickness + measured clearance - desired clearance = required shim thickness.
Apply a light coat of engine oil to the replacement shim(s) and install.
Install the camshafts.
